Unlocking the Digital Treasure Chest: Monetizing Your Website or Blog with Digital Products

Monetizing your website or blog opens up a world of opportunities to turn your passion into profits. One of the most lucrative methods is by creating and selling digital products. Whether it’s ebooks, online courses, or exclusive content, these virtual treasures can become a reliable source of income while providing immense value to your audience. Let’s delve into the key steps to monetize your platform through digital products:

1. Identify Your Niche and Audience:

  • Define your expertise: Pinpoint your area of expertise and passion to create digital products that resonate with your audience.
  • Understand your audience: Conduct market research to grasp your audience’s needs, pain points, and preferences.
2. Conceptualize Your Digital Products:
  • eBooks: Compile your knowledge and insights into comprehensive ebooks that address your audience’s challenges or offer valuable information.
  • Online Courses: Design in-depth courses that provide step-by-step guidance and actionable content to help your audience achieve specific goals.
  • Exclusive Content: Offer premium content or membership plans with exclusive access to behind-the-scenes, in-depth insights, or interactive sessions.
3. Create High-Quality Content:
  • Embrace thorough research: Deliver well-researched and accurate information to establish authority and build trust with your audience.
  • Engaging format: Utilize visuals, videos, and interactive elements to enhance the learning experience and keep your audience captivated.
4. Set Competitive Pricing:
  • Analyze the market: Research pricing strategies of similar digital products to set competitive and appealing prices.
  • Offer tiered options: Consider offering different price points for various packages, providing flexibility to cater to different budget preferences.
5. Utilize Secure Payment Gateways:
  • Choose trusted gateways: Integrate reputable payment processors to ensure secure and smooth transactions for your customers.
  • Provide multiple payment options: Offer various payment methods, such as credit cards and PayPal, to accommodate diverse customer preferences.
6. Leverage Email Marketing:
  • Build an email list: Encourage website visitors to subscribe to your mailing list for updates and special offers on your digital products.
  • Personalized promotions: Utilize email marketing to deliver personalized promotions and nurture customer relationships.
7. Create Compelling Sales Pages:
  • Craft persuasive copy: Develop captivating sales pages that highlight the benefits of your digital products and address potential objections.
  • Use attention-grabbing visuals: Include eye-catching graphics and multimedia elements to enhance the appeal of your sales pages.
8. Provide Exceptional Customer Support:
  • Prompt response: Offer timely and helpful customer support to address inquiries or concerns related to your digital products.
  • Encourage feedback: Welcome customer feedback to improve your offerings and enhance the overall user experience.
9. Partner with Influencers and Affiliates:
  • Collaborate with influencers: Partner with influencers in your niche to promote your digital products to their dedicated audience.
  • Set up an affiliate program: Offer incentives for affiliates to promote and sell your digital products, expanding your reach and sales potential.
10. Monitor Performance and Iterate:
  • Track sales and analytics: Monitor sales performance and user behavior to identify areas for improvement and optimization.
  • Continuously improve: Adapt your digital products based on customer feedback and emerging trends to offer the best possible value.

Crafting an Inviting Online Haven: Website Design and User Experience Tips

In the bustling digital world, where attention spans are fleeting, crafting an attractive and user-friendly website is essential to captivate your audience and build a robust online presence. Your website design and user experience play a pivotal role in leaving a lasting impression on visitors. Let’s delve into key tips to create a captivating virtual haven:

1. Embrace a Clean and Intuitive Layout:

  • Streamlined design: Simplify your website layout to present information in a clear and organized manner.
  • Intuitive navigation: Ensure easy navigation with a well-structured menu and user-friendly buttons.
2. Mobile Responsiveness:
  • Prioritize mobile users: Design your website to adapt seamlessly to various screen sizes, ensuring an optimal experience for mobile visitors.
  • Test thoroughly: Regularly test your website on different devices to identify and rectify any display issues.
3. Optimize Loading Speed:
  • Swift loading times: Optimize images, reduce unnecessary scripts, and leverage caching techniques to speed up your website’s loading time.
  • Keep it light: Minimize heavy multimedia elements that may slow down your site’s performance.
4. Prioritize Readability:
  • Clear typography: Use legible fonts and maintain a consistent font size throughout your website.
  • Ample white space: Give content room to breathe by incorporating sufficient white space for improved readability.
5. Engaging Visuals:
  • High-quality images: Use eye-catching visuals that resonate with your brand and complement your content.
  • Relevant multimedia: Incorporate videos and infographics to convey information in a captivating manner.
6. Create a Compelling Call-to-Action (CTA):
  • Standout CTA buttons: Use contrasting colors for CTA buttons to draw attention and encourage visitor action.
  • Persuasive language: Craft compelling CTA text that prompts visitors to take the desired action, whether it’s making a purchase, subscribing to a newsletter, or contacting you.
7. Implement User-Focused Forms:
  • Keep it brief: Create concise and user-friendly forms that ask for essential information only.
  • Real-time validation: Offer instant feedback for form submissions to ensure users provide accurate data.
8. Ensure Consistent Branding:
  • Cohesive colors and visuals: Maintain consistency with your brand colors, logo, and overall visual identity across the website.
  • Reflect your tone: Infuse your brand’s voice and personality into your content to establish a strong connection with your audience.
9. Test for Usability:
  • Conduct usability tests: Request feedback from friends, colleagues, or focus groups to identify potential pain points and areas for improvement.
  • Monitor user behavior: Utilize tools like heatmaps and analytics to analyze user interactions and optimize your website accordingly.
10. Provide Excellent Customer Support:
  • Visible contact information: Display your contact details prominently, allowing visitors to reach out for inquiries or assistance.
  • Live chat option: Offer a real-time chat feature to provide immediate support and address customer queries.

Your Digital Identity Unveiled: Choosing a Domain Name and Hosting Provider for Building an Online Presence

In the vast expanse of the internet, establishing a strong online presence is essential for individuals and businesses alike. To embark on this digital journey, two critical elements stand at the forefront: choosing the perfect domain name and finding the right hosting provider. Let’s explore these key steps in building your digital identity:

1. Selecting the Ideal Domain Name:

  • Reflect your brand: Your domain name should align with your brand, making it easy for visitors to associate with your identity.
  • Keep it simple and memorable: Choose a concise and easily memorable name to ensure your audience can find you effortlessly.
  • Avoid complex spellings: Steer clear of unconventional spellings or hyphens that may confuse or deter potential visitors.
  • Consider your niche: If possible, incorporate keywords related to your niche to enhance search engine visibility.
2. Evaluating Domain Extensions:
  • Opt for .com whenever possible: While other extensions like .net or .org are acceptable, .com remains the most familiar and trusted.
  • Geographic relevance: If your website caters to a specific location, consider country-specific extensions like .us or .uk.
3. Identifying a Reliable Hosting Provider:
  • Assess your needs: Determine your website’s requirements in terms of traffic, storage, and website type (e.g., blog, e-commerce).
  • Uptime guarantee: Choose a hosting provider that offers a high uptime guarantee to ensure your website is accessible at all times.
  • Scalability: Consider future growth and select a hosting plan that allows easy scaling when your website traffic increases.
4. Understanding Different Hosting Types:
  • Shared Hosting: Ideal for beginners with lower traffic websites, as multiple websites share the same server resources.
  • VPS Hosting: Offers more control and resources than shared hosting, suitable for growing websites with moderate traffic.
  • Dedicated Hosting: Provides exclusive server resources for high-traffic websites with robust performance demands.
5. Checking Performance and Speed:
  • Load time matters: Opt for a hosting provider with fast server response times to ensure a smooth user experience.
  • Content Delivery Network (CDN): Consider a hosting provider that includes a CDN to accelerate website loading times globally.
6. Examining Customer Support:
  • 24/7 support: Prioritize a hosting provider that offers round-the-clock customer support for any technical issues.
  • Communication channels: Look for multiple support channels such as live chat, email, and phone for quick assistance.
7. Security Features:
  • SSL Certificate: Ensure your hosting provider includes an SSL certificate to encrypt data and establish a secure connection.
  • Regular backups: Choose a provider that offers automatic backups to safeguard your data in case of any unexpected events.
8. Cost and Value:
  • Balance cost and features: Evaluate different hosting plans to find the one that provides the best value for your budget.
  • Watch for introductory pricing: Be aware of initial promotional rates that may increase when renewing your hosting plan.

Building Your Digital Footprint: Setting Up a Website or Blog for Online Presence

In today’s digital landscape, having an online presence is crucial for individuals and businesses alike. Whether you’re a budding entrepreneur, a passionate blogger, or an artist showcasing your talents, setting up a website or blog is the first step to establish your online identity. Let’s dive into the essential steps to build your digital home:

1. Choose the Right Platform:

  • Evaluate your needs: Consider your goals, technical expertise, and budget to select the best platform for your website or blog.
  • Popular options: WordPress, Wix, and Squarespace are user-friendly platforms with customizable templates for various purposes.
2. Register a Domain Name:
  • Reflect your identity: Pick a domain name that aligns with your brand, making it memorable and easy to spell.
  • Use a reputable registrar: Choose a reliable domain registrar to secure your domain for the long term.
3. Select Hosting Services:
  • Opt for reliable hosting: Find a reputable hosting provider that offers reliable uptime, security features, and customer support.
  • Consider scalability: Anticipate future growth and choose a hosting plan that can accommodate increased traffic and data.
4. Design Your Website or Blog:
  • Keep it clean and user-friendly: Prioritize a clean layout and intuitive navigation for a positive user experience.
  • Showcase your branding: Incorporate your logo, color scheme, and brand elements to maintain consistency.
5. Craft Engaging Content:
  • Know your audience: Understand your target audience’s interests and pain points to create relevant and compelling content.
  • Mix it up: Incorporate text, images, videos, and infographics to diversify your content and keep readers engaged.
6. Implement SEO Strategies:
  • Use relevant keywords: Conduct keyword research and optimize your content to rank higher in search engine results.
  • Meta tags and descriptions: Craft descriptive meta tags and meta descriptions to entice users to click on your website in search results.
7. Add Contact Information:
  • Enable easy communication: Include a contact page with your email address or contact form to encourage inquiries and collaboration.
  • Consider a chat option: Offer real-time support through chat services to enhance user engagement.
8. Mobile Optimization:
  • Responsive design: Ensure your website adapts seamlessly to various devices, including smartphones and tablets.
  • Test for performance: Regularly test your site’s loading speed and optimize it for quick loading on all devices.
9. Integrate Social Media:
  • Expand your reach: Add social media buttons to enable visitors to easily share your content on different platforms.
  • Engage with your audience: Regularly post updates and interact with followers to build a loyal online community.
10. Monitor Analytics:
  • Track performance: Utilize web analytics tools like Google Analytics to monitor website traffic, user behavior, and content performance.
  • Make data-driven decisions: Analyze the data to identify areas for improvement and tailor your strategies for better results.
